How can I speed up this Compaq with XP??

  1. #1
    presario 3000 is offline Newbie

    How can I speed up this Compaq with XP??

    My Compaq Presario 3000 notebook computer is not nearly as fast as it once was. It is a Pentium 4, 2.4 with 60 gig hard drive running Windows XP Home. I've defragmented the disc several times, and that did not help.

    When I first bought the computer it used to boot up extremely fast -- going from off to ready to work in about fifteen seconds. Now it takes up to five minutes or so before it will allow me to perform some functions. The boot process still seems fast judging by the screen, but even after the screen looks ready, the hard drive light keeps flashing for a long time. And I can't access most programs for five minutes or so. The computer seems to be busy doing something - I have no idea what it is doing.

    The problem seemed to begin when I installed Norton firewall. Prior to that I had Norton Anti-Virus, and it worked fine. That version of Norton (2003 I think) did not have a firewall included. After installing a second CD with a separate Norton Firewall and some other Norton stuff on the CD, the problem started.

    I uninstalled the Norton Firewall, but the slowness continued. Since then I've reinstalled a newer Norton version (2004) with an integrated firewall.

    Any ideas how to fix this? I've also wondered how I can monitor what the computer hard drive is doing when this happens.

    Do you have SP2?
    When you uninstalled the Norton Firewall & Stuff did you manualy search for leftovers & or clean the registry?


    also: look in your event viewer: rt. click My Computer then click Manage then Event Viewer.
    open the system as well as the application and security tabs & look for X errors. click error line for details. post back the source & event id especially of errors that seem to coincide with startups.
